The last offer of import CRC from China was priced at $600/mt, against $606/mt over the last weeks, CFR conditions for shipments to a port in the South or Southeastern coast of Brazil, with the 1008/SPCC grade as reference.
In October, Brazil imported 3,600 mt of CRC, while exporting 3,000 mt of the product, comparable to 8,300 mt and 7,000 mt, respectively, in September.
The main origins of the imports in October were China (1,400 mt at $538/mt), Sweden (1,200 mt at $811/mt) and South Korea (800 mt at $715/mt) all FOB conditions.
The exports of October were all destined to South American countries, shipped by Usiminas (1,900 mt at $555/mt), ArcelorMittal (400 mt at $502/mt), traders (400 mt at 639/mt) and CSN (200 mt at $607/mt), all FOB conditions.
In the Brazilian domestic market, CRC of the basic commercial grades is currently offered in medium to large volumes by the producers at BRL 4,259/mt ($787/mt), against BRL 4,038/mt two weeks ago, ex-works, no taxes included.
USD = BRL 5.41 (November 11)
